我尝试将我的一些包移植到新的meteor 0.9 rc上。3个中有2个工作,第3个有一个hack,当通过meteor add
安装时确实工作。
是否有办法从流星包服务器中删除已发布的包?我不希望在存储库中出现一个损坏的包
目前无法在meteor的打包服务器和atmosphere上删除已发布的包。
你可以做的是创建一个新的版本,它有一个空的Package.onUse
。还有为什么是空的评论。这使得你的包是惰性的,并确保你不会破坏任何人的项目。
后期编辑:
现在可以使用set-unmigrate
在搜索结果中隐藏它 meteor admin set-unmigrated YOURPACKAGE
不可能从atmosphere.js中删除包,但可以使用。meteor admin set-unmigrated PACKAGE-NAME
。但是这不会阻止用户在他们的项目中添加包。meteor add PACKAGE-NAME
。
在这种情况下,放置空的Package是有意义的。使用并更新Marco在他的回答中强调的包